Boosting Mental Health
Engaging in activities you love can significantly improve your mental health. Studies show that hobbies can reduce stress and anxiety. When you immerse yourself in something you enjoy, your mind shifts focus away from daily worries.
For instance, if you enjoy painting, spending time with your brushes and colors can be a form of meditation. The act of creating can be therapeutic, allowing you to express emotions that may be difficult to articulate.
Moreover, following your interests can boost your self-esteem. Mastering a new skill or completing a project can give you a sense of accomplishment. This feeling can translate into other areas of your life, making you more confident in your abilities.

Overcoming Challenges
Following your interests is not always easy. You may face challenges along the way, such as time constraints or self-doubt. However, overcoming these obstacles can be part of the journey.
For instance, if you want to learn a new language but struggle to find time, consider setting small, achievable goals. Even dedicating just 10 minutes a day to practice can lead to significant progress over time.
Additionally, it is essential to be kind to yourself during this process. Everyone learns at their own pace, and it is okay to make mistakes. Embracing the learning curve can make the experience more enjoyable.

Making Time for Your Interests
In our busy lives, it can be challenging to make time for our interests. However, prioritizing these activities is essential for a balanced life.
Start by scheduling time for your passions, just as you would for work or appointments. Block out time in your calendar to ensure you have dedicated moments for what you love.
Additionally, consider integrating your interests into your daily routine. For example, if you enjoy reading, carry a book with you to read during your commute or lunch break.
